Review at AudioGals

I’m over at AudioGals with a review of Roommate by Sarina Bowen, narrated by Teddy Hamilton & Stephen Dexter. Teddy Hamilton is always a pleasure to listen to and Sarina Bowen once again doesn’t fail me. The narration by Stephen Dexter was a little less successful but overall, a win. Recommend.

Review at AudioGals

I’m over at AudioGals with a review of Managed by Kristen Callihan, narrated by Rupert Channing & Charlotte North. Fabulous narration and a great story – forced proximity with a grumpy one plus a sunshiney one!
